    SAP HCM Solution Analyst

    Job Responsibilities

    • Design and implement systems solutions: In collaboration with other SAP Solution Analysts and Technical Team members, provide advice to management and stakeholders, recommend a course of action for required solutions in the following areas: solution scoping, requirements analysis, gap analysis, feasibility, functional design, application configuration, technical specification, testing, production deployment, support and training.
    • Actively engage with HRIS and all interested stakeholders and representative user groups in determining business requirements and solution strategy.
    • Communicate recommendations, consult with Technical Team members, review progress, demonstrate interim work results, conduct user testing and coordinate release to production.
    • Manage projects from initiation to completion, ensuring adherence to timelines, budgets, and quality standards. Coordinate with internal and external stakeholders to prioritize tasks and mitigate risks.
    • Provide support and subject matter expertise during the execution of testing activities and resolve any specific issues identified during testing.
    • Proactively identify opportunities for improvement and propose enhancements to existing systems or processes to optimize HR operations.
    • Escalated production support as needed.

    Skills / Qualifications

    • B.Sc. or Business degree or equivalent
    • Must have at least 5-7 years of experience as an SAP HCM Consultant or similar role
    • Should have knowledge and working experience of various functionalities of HCM including:
    • Time Management (TM) and Personnel Administration (PA)
    • Compensation Management including long-term incentives.
    • Integration of SAP with third parties including SuccessFactors
    • Integration points within SAP HCM to FI, SD, PS, etc.
    • Communication: Strong verbal and written communication skills to interact with internal clients, gather requirements, and explain complex technical concepts in an understandable manner.
    • Problem-Solving: Strong analytical skills to troubleshoot issues, optimize solutions, and address business requirements effectively. Precision in configuring and documenting HR processes to ensure accuracy and compliance.
    • Documentation Skills: - Experience in reverse engineering the SAP HCM solutions, documenting the functional specification for the HCM configurations.
    • Experience in working with ABAP developers on technical solutions; basic ABAP understanding is a plus, but not required.
    • Results-oriented, self-starter, capable of working independently and within a team environment to meet deadlines.
    • Ability to manage demanding and time-constrained tasks effectively.  Experience in establishing a project plan and facilitating the setting of priorities.
    • Willing to work outside of normal business hours as part of a global team.

    Environmental Graduate

    Job Responsibilities

    As an Junior Environmental Scientist, you will be responsible for:

    • Compilation of environmental management plans and monitoring procedures
    • Manage the implementation and maintenance of environmental monitoring plans and procedures
    • Assist in the planning and execution of a range of environmental monitoring programs
    • Collect various environmental samples, ensuring adherence to standard protocols, safety practises, and environmental procedures
    • Record and maintain accurate field date and sample logs
    • Perform preliminary analysis of water, air quality, terrestrial, aquatic and noise samples
    • Maintain, calibrate and trouble shoot monitoring equipment to ensure accurate data collection
    • Ensure that all field instrumentations and equipment are in proper working order
    • Assist in the collation of environmental data and preparation of detailed reports on a range of environmental aspects
    • Identify and manage risks onsite, and communicate risks to the Environmental Team
    • Liaise with the onsite Environmental Team for support as necessary
    • Participate in onsite coordination meetings with the Environmental Team
    • Assist with the implementation of protocols to ensure that the onsite workplace complies with safety, health, environmental and quality standards
    • Participate and review in the drafting of Journey Management Plans for work procedures and daily toolbox talks for the onsite Environmental Team
    • Working collaboratively with the Africa, Europe & Middle East Environment & Sustainability team to support on international projects on an as needed basis

    Applicant Requirements

    • Bachelor's degree: Honours /Master's will be beneficial in Environmental Science, Environmental Management, Biological Science, or a related field
    •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
    •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
    • Good communication skills and the ability to accurately record and report data (both qualitative and quantitative)
    • Valid driver’s license
    • High proficiency with standard industry software tools (e.g., Microsoft Project, Microsoft Office suite)
